Zen mastery is a profound state of spiritual and mental attainment rooted in the teachings of Zen Buddhism, a branch of Mahayana Buddhism that emphasizes direct experience and intuitive understanding. Achieving Zen mastery involves cultivating a deep awareness of the present moment, transcending the limitations of thought and ego, and attaining a heightened state of clarity, insight, and inner peace.
Practitioners of Zen mastery engage in rigorous meditation practices, such as Zazen (seated meditation), Koan study (pondering paradoxical questions), and mindfulness techniques. Through disciplined practice and guidance from experienced Zen teachers, individuals embark on a transformative journey that leads to a profound shift in their perception of reality.
Zen mastery goes beyond intellectual understanding, inviting practitioners to embrace a holistic way of being. It encourages letting go of attachments, desires, and judgments, enabling a direct experience of the interconnectedness of all things. By transcending dualistic thinking and merging with the present moment, practitioners may unlock a deep wellspring of wisdom, compassion, and a sense of interconnectedness with all existence.
Attaining Zen mastery is a lifelong pursuit, and the path is marked by both profound insights and humbling challenges. As individuals progress, they may experience moments of satori, or sudden enlightenment, where the nature of reality is perceived in a new and transformative way. However, Zen mastery is not a destination but an ongoing journey, inviting practitioners to continually deepen their understanding and integrate their insights into daily life.
In essence, Zen mastery is a profound spiritual awakening that transcends the limitations of the ego, allowing individuals to live with heightened awareness, authenticity, and a deep sense of unity with the world around them. It is a testament to the transformative power of disciplined practice, inner exploration, and the profound teachings of Zen Buddhism.
